Troubleshooting Common Amibroker Data Feed Issues
Encountering issues with your Amibroker data can be frustrating . Often, these setbacks stem from straightforward resolution. First, verify your link to the data provider ; a brief network outage is a frequent culprit. Next, make sure the file format —such as CSV —is properly configured within Amibroker's options. Also, investigate the time format ; mismatched times can cause errors . Finally, keep in mind that Amibroker’s system might require a restart to implement changes or clear stored values.
Optimizing Amibroker Data Performance for Faster Analysis
To secure best speed in your Amibroker study, prioritizing data handling is vital. Often extensive datasets can significantly hinder backtesting and real-time charting. Thus, applying techniques such as periodically clearing cache files, optimizing data directory paths, and verifying the integrity of your data files can dramatically boost overall velocity. Consider also changing data to a better structure if relevant to your investment approach.
